MsSql高效数据处理与导入导出实战指南

MsSql作为微软推出的关系型数据库系统,在企业级应用中广泛应用。高效的数据处理与导入导出是日常运维和开发中的重要环节,直接影响系统的性能与数据一致性。

在数据处理方面,优化查询语句是关键。避免使用SELECT ,而是明确指定需要的字段,减少不必要的数据传输。同时,合理使用索引可以大幅提升查询效率,但需注意索引的维护成本。

对于大数据量的导入导出,建议使用SQL Server Integration Services (SSIS) 或者 bcp 工具。SSIS 提供图形化界面,支持复杂的ETL流程;而 bcp 命令行工具则适合批量处理,速度快且资源占用低。

导出数据时,可选择将数据导出为CSV、Excel或SQL脚本文件。对于结构化数据,生成SQL脚本便于后续恢复或迁移。而CSV格式则更适合与其他系统进行数据交换。

AI绘图结果,仅供参考

在执行大规模数据操作时,应考虑事务控制与错误处理。确保每一步操作都能回滚,避免因异常导致数据不一致。•定期备份数据库也是防止数据丢失的重要措施。

•利用SQL Server的内置工具如“导入和导出向导”,可以快速完成简单的数据迁移任务。但对于复杂场景,仍需结合脚本或第三方工具实现更精细的控制。

dawei

【声明】:邵阳站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。